LEGISLATIVE BUDGET BOARD Austin, Texas FISCAL NOTE, 82ND LEGISLATIVE REGULAR SESSION May 11, 2011 TO: Honorable John Carona, Chair, Senate Committee on Business & Commerce FROM: John S O'Brien, Director, Legislative Budget Board IN RE:HB8 by Darby (Relating to prohibiting certain private transfer fees and the preservation of private real property rights; providing penalties.), As Engrossed No significant fiscal implication to the State is anticipated. The bill would amend the Property Code relating to prohibiting certain private transfer fees and the preservation of private real property rights; providing penalties. Based on the analysis of the General Land Office and Veterans' Land Board, the Office of the Attorney General and the Texas Real Estate Commission, it is assumed that duties and responsibilities associated with implementing the provisions of the bill could be accomplished by utilizing existing resources. Local Government Impact No significant fiscal implication to units of local government is anticipated.
